Steps to Remembering How to Spell Penicillin

Break Up the Word into Syllables

The first step to remembering how to spell penicillin is to break up the word into syllables. The word is made up of three syllables: ‘pen’, ‘i’, and ‘cillin’. This makes it easier to remember each part of the word separately.

Associate the Syllables with Visuals

Once you have broken up the word into its syllables, it is helpful to associate each syllable with a visual. For example, you can imagine a pen writing the word ‘pen’, a small insect for the syllable ‘i’, and a medicine bottle for the syllable ‘cillin’. This will help you to remember the word more easily.

Practice Writing the Word

The final step to remembering how to spell penicillin is to practice writing the word. You can do this by writing the word several times on a piece of paper or typing it out on a computer. This will help to reinforce the correct spelling of the word in your mind.

Q5: Is Penicillin still effective against bacterial infections?

A5: Yes, Penicillin is still effective against many bacterial infections. However, some bacteria have developed resistance to Penicillin, so it may not be effective in all cases.
